I don't know about that sim specifically, but most flight sims have the ability to bind absolute head rotation to joystick axis. It should be really easy to make a program that turns the Rift orientation into euler angles and feeds them into a virtual joystick. You might need the ability to set a scaling factor to get it 1:1 (and a centering button), but there wouldn't be any drift at least.
